A loud crash came from behind.

The black car forcibly changed lanes and crashed into other vehicles.

However, it quickly caught up again.

Julian Thorne looked in the rearview mirror and was now certain that the black car was indeed following him.

He intended to quickly shift lanes, but hesitated and slowed down a bit.

Julian Thorne quickly activated the car’s onboard system and called Special Assistant Linden.

“Hello, Master Julian p>

Julian Thorne: “Someone is following me p>

“In the Central Avenue area, come quickly with people p>

Linden’s voice instantly raised: “What p>

“Master Julian, are you okay p>

“I’ll be right there, hold on p>

Julian Thorne hung up the phone and half-turned to glance at Vivian Sinclair in the back seat.

Her face was full of regret, regretting getting on Julian Thorne’s troublesome boat tonight.

But in her panic, she still managed to free one hand to tightly cover her belly.

It seems, although she didn’t think much of her not-so-great husband, she valued the child in her belly very much.

From her pale face, it seemed she was also having trouble holding back her pregnancy nausea.

Julian Thorne knew the car couldn’t keep racing like this, or it would be extremely dangerous for the pregnant woman.

At this moment, even he didn’t realize his unusual attentiveness.

The four-million-dollar Bentley weaved through the lanes, each time changing lanes and accelerating managed to shake off the pursuing car a bit.

But soon, the other car would catch up again.

Julian Thorne knew that at this rate, the pregnant woman would definitely end up dead here today.

Julian Thorne activated the map, looked at the nearby terrain and route distribution, and quickly came up with an idea to shake off the black car.

He slowed down and intentionally or unintentionally acted like he was anxious to shake them off quickly.

Soon, at a downhill intersection, Julian Thorne deliberately made a sudden turn.

The black car seemed to have anticipated his move, suddenly accelerating towards the Bentley—

Julian Thorne made a sharp drifting turn, watching as the other car rushed head-on towards them, but his car made another sharp turn.

The car squeezed into the non-motorized lane.

Meanwhile, the car behind crashed into a wall with a ’bang p>

Fortunately, there were almost no pedestrians or electric vehicles on the road by then, so Julian Thorne could quickly dart through and squeeze into a small alley.

By the time the car behind reacted, his car’s tail was already disappearing at the other end of the street.

Vivian Sinclair gave a ’waa—’ before she couldn’t hold back and vomited.

Julian Thorne frowned tightly and parked the car in a dark corner.

He then quickly got out of the car and helped Vivian Sinclair out.

“Let’s go p>

Julian Thorne abandoned the car and led Vivian Sinclair into a dark alley.

Vivian Sinclair, having just vomited, was in very poor spirits.

But she still asked in confusion, “You’ve already shaken them off, why abandon the car p>

Julian Thorne: “I suspect I was being watched at the hospital’s underground parking lot p>

Vivian Sinclair realized: “So you suspect there might be a tracker on your car p>

Julian Thorne was surprised by Vivian’s quick thinking.

“You’re very smart p>

But, considering her hidden identity, he quickly accepted it.

Vivian Sinclair: “Thank you for the compliment, but I wonder, can’t I stop running with you p>

“After all, they’re after you, not me p>

Saying this, she stopped, leaning against the wall, panting heavily.

Vivian Sinclair, concerned for her belly, really didn’t dare to continue.

In the darkness, Julian Thorne’s face was unreadable, “Miss Sinclair’s cold-heartedness is understandable, given the situation p>

“However p>

Before he finished speaking, hurried footsteps came from the alley entrance.

“This way, that way p>

“Search p>

Vivian Sinclair’s face changed dramatically, her heart leaping to her throat.

Before she could react, Julian Thorne grabbed her and started running quickly.

“We’re like grasshoppers on a string, these people won’t let you go tonight p>

Julian Thorne was telling the truth.

If they were targeted at the hospital, Vivian Sinclair was indeed aboard Julian Thorne’s troublesome ship.

At least tonight, where else could she run to?

If caught, she might become a hostage!

She felt a wave of despair, thinking she just wanted his children, how come she couldn’t rid herself of him?

Soon, their movements were discovered.

“Stop p>

The pursuers came into the alley from behind.

Vivian Sinclair felt increasingly uncomfortable in her belly.

She frowned more tightly, but understood she couldn’t stop, or become a burden.

She glanced around, thinking of finding another way out.

Suddenly, Vivian Sinclair felt her body abruptly lift.

She looked down in surprise to find that Julian Thorne had picked her up.

“Apologies, Miss Sinclair p>

“This way we can end this quickly p>

He didn’t consult or hesitate for a second.

He said, and then started sprinting away with Vivian Sinclair in his arms.

The wind whistled past her ears, forcing Vivian Sinclair to bury her head.

And her warm breath, like feathers, lightly brushed Julian Thorne’s neck, making his body tense like a drawn bow.

However, Julian Thorne just glanced down at the small pregnant woman hiding her face in his arms, then darted like a cheetah into the darkness at the alley’s end.

But it was unclear how long these people had been lying in wait for him.

Today, with Julian Thorne finally alone, they pounced like starving wolves.

When Julian Thorne emerged from the alley, a group of men in black surrounded him.

“President Thorne p>

“Last time, your men hurt us. This time, it’s your turn to feel the pain, right p>

Julian Thorne scoffed coldly.

“A bunch of gutter rats p>

“Enough talk. Even with one hand, you won’t take me tonight p>

The men in black laughed arrogantly: “President Thorne, don’t brag p>

“At a time like this, you even brought a beauty along. Let’s see who you can protect p>

Then they lunged towards him.

Julian Thorne whispered softly to Vivian Sinclair, “Hold tight to me p>

He then held Vivian with one arm, while with the other, he picked up a stick from beside the wall to fend off the incoming machete.

The group attacked swiftly and viciously.

Vivian heard several muffled sounds.

Her entire body trembled with fear.

But she never lifted her head.

Nor did she scream in panic.

Even though Vivian was scared to death inside, with her heart in her throat, she still gritted her teeth.

Screams rang in her ears, but thankfully none belonged to Julian Thorne.

Until she faintly smelled blood.

Just as she was about to look up, a large hand quickly pushed her head back down.

“Don’t let them see your face p>

After saying this, Julian Thorne leapt with her, jumping straight off the roadside.

He landed steadily, and Vivian felt Julian hugging her tightly as he ran.

Until he suddenly stopped.

Only then did Vivian look up, realizing Julian had brought her under a bridge.

Julian nestled Vivian into a hidden corner, covering her with a heap of debris nearby.

“Unless I come back personally, don’t come out for anyone p>

“Did you hear me p>

Under the dark bridge, Julian solemnly held Vivian’s shoulders. After speaking seriously, he quickly left the bridge.

Vivian touched the spot Julian had just touched.

It felt damp.

She brought it to her nose and nearly gagged.

It was the smell of blood.

However, she couldn’t tell if it was Julian’s blood or that of the attackers.

Vivian waited a long time.

She waited until she felt cold all over, and her legs were numb.

Until she heard footsteps again.

The footsteps grew closer, eventually stopping right before Vivian.

Remembering Julian’s instructions, Vivian froze, utterly still.

The person sat beside her, and Vivian heard a low voice.

“It’s me, Julian Thorne p>

“I’ve drawn those people away p>

“Miss Sinclair, there’s no need to be afraid anymore p>

Upon hearing it was him, Vivian quickly threw off all the debris covering her.

Vivian: “Are you alright p>

“I’ve called the police. Even if they come back, we don’t need to be afraid p>

Julian saw her sharpness and smiled slightly.

He nodded slightly, then closed his eyes without saying more.

Vivian sensed something was wrong with Julian and quickly turned on her phone’s flashlight.

But before she could shine it on his face, Julian raised his hand to block the light.

“Shh p>

“It’s too bright p>

“Don’t worry, my people will come soon p>

“Miss Sinclair, I have something, in my chest pocket p>

“Would you like to take it p>

Vivian: “At a time like this, what would I want from you p>

“Stop talking already p>

“I’ll call for an ambulance p>

Julian directly took her phone.

“No rush p>

“Remember to look at this, Miss Sinclair p>

“It’s the reason I’ll be visiting you in the hospital tonight p>

After speaking, Julian lost consciousness, his head resting on Vivian’s shoulder.

Vivian shined the light on his face and saw it was indeed stained with blood.

But what shocked her more was the open wound on Julian’s shoulder.

It was not only bleeding but the flesh was torn open!

Vivian recalled the details.

Julian had been doing his utmost to protect her, so even though he was injured, she wasn’t hurt at all!

Moreover, his arms holding her didn’t even shake.

This left Vivian astonished, unable to fathom how he managed it.

Looking at the bloody wound, Vivian’s heart couldn’t help but tremble fiercely.

Who would have thought that the most powerful man in Ardis possessed such extraordinary combat ability?

This made him seem like an enigma, truly unfathomable.

Yet even in danger, he didn’t abandon her, a pregnant woman who was a burden, making Vivian admire him from the depths of her heart.

She was also glad her unborn child had his genetic legacy.

“Hey, Mr. Thorne p>

“Mr. Thorne, wake up p>

He was completely unconscious.

Fearing he’d lose too much blood, Vivian quickly took off her coat.

She fashioned it into a bandage and used all her strength to bind it tightly around Julian’s wound.

Hoping it would help somehow.

Next was to wait for his people to arrive!

After doing all this, Vivian was exhausted, leaning against the wall to catch her breath.

Suddenly, she remembered what Julian told her.

In the chest pocket, was the reason he’d come to visit her in the hospital?

Vivian couldn’t resist reaching over to retrieve it.

First, her hand touched firm muscle.

The feel was good, very solid.

However, she wasn’t some lustful woman right now, so she focused and quickly found the pocket.

It was a piece of paper.

Vivian took it out and spread it over her knee.

Then turned on her phone’s flashlight again.

It was a drawing.

A drawing that left Vivian speechless upon seeing it.

It was darn well… the thing she couldn’t help but leave in the boy’s sketchbook at the sanatorium the other day p>
